A Unitary Construction of Takagi-Sugeno Fuzzy Fault Detection Filters

摘要

The unitary approach to fault detection filters design, intended to Takagi-Sugeno fuzzy continuous-time systems, is presented in the paper. Based on fuzzy observers guaranteing asymptotic convergence of the state estimation error, the matrix gains of all linear components of the fuzzy filter are designed to obtain the same singular values of the filter transfer function matrix. Related to the fuzzy state control, and for systems under influence of actuator faults, the problems are revealed for a three-tank system plant.
